How do I reactivate my account?
To reactivate your selling account, please send us the following information:
– Copies of invoices, receipts, contracts, delivery orders, or authorization letters from your supplier issued in the last 365 days. The quantity of items shown should match your inventory.
– If you are not the brand owner, provide an authorization letter and a complete set of documentation, including authorization letters, to prove a valid supply chain.
– If you are the brand owner, provide a copy of the brand registration certificate, and business license or personal identity card.
– Contact information for your supplier, including name, phone number, address, email, and website.
You can send .pdf, .jpg, .png, or .gif files. These documents must be authentic and unaltered. We may call your supplier to verify the documents. You may remove pricing information, but the rest of the document must be visible. We will maintain the confidentiality of your supplier contact information.
How do I send the required information?
To submit this information, please follow the instructions in the banner at the top of your Account Health page in Seller Central ()
What happens if I do not send the requested information?
If we do not receive the requested information within 17 days, or after two unsuccessful appeals (whichever occurs sooner), we may not allow you to sell on Amazon. Failure to successfully appeal this decision may result in payments being continuously withheld.

真贋3ASINは、販売した、販売していないではなく、
出品していたのでしょうか?それとも出品していないのでしょうか?
FBA納品していたのであれば、請求書提出で真正品を証明。
ドロップシッピングであれば、正直に経緯と仕入れ予定先情報を詳しく記載し、改善計画を内容を自分の言葉で簡潔に申し立てされてみてはいかがでしょうか。
・問題の根本原因。
・問題を解決するために何をしたか。
・今後問題が発生しないために何をするか。
ドロッピシッピングでしたら、
根本原因把握と今後何をするかが 一番重要だと思います。
